Copart Q2 2021 Earnings Report

Copart's financial performance increased in the second quarter of fiscal year 2021.

Key Takeaways

Copart reported an increase in revenue, gross profit, and net income for the quarter ended January 31, 2021, compared to the same period last year. Revenue increased by 7.3%, gross profit increased by 18.3%, and net income increased by 14.7%.

Revenue increased by $41.9 million, or 7.3%, compared to the same period last year.

Gross profit increased by $47.6 million, or 18.3%, compared to the same period last year.

Net income increased by $24.7 million, or 14.7%, compared to the same period last year.

Fully diluted earnings per share increased by 14.1% to $0.81 compared to $0.71 last year.
